From 5f32f8ec216dce755aa7fffb62e8bc7b06441cea Mon Sep 17 00:00:00 2001 From: mithun522 Date: Thu, 28 Mar 2024 10:22:14 +0530 Subject: [PATCH] Fix #47967 modal rendering issue --- components/modal/Modal.tsx | 9 ++++++++- 1 file changed, 8 insertions(+), 1 deletion(-) diff --git a/components/modal/Modal.tsx b/components/modal/Modal.tsx index ece95afb9482..7f0bc83d1b12 100644 --- a/components/modal/Modal.tsx +++ b/components/modal/Modal.tsx @@ -1,7 +1,7 @@ -import * as React from 'react'; import CloseOutlined from '@ant-design/icons/CloseOutlined'; import classNames from 'classnames'; import Dialog from 'rc-dialog'; +import * as React from 'react'; import useClosable from '../_util/hooks/useClosable'; import { useZIndex } from '../_util/hooks/useZIndex'; @@ -144,6 +144,13 @@ const Modal: React.FC = (props) => { maskTransitionName={getTransitionName(rootPrefixCls, 'fade', props.maskTransitionName)} className={classNames(hashId, className, modal?.className)} style={{ ...modal?.style, ...style }} + bodyStyle={{ + maxHeight: 'calc(70vh - 60px)', + overflowY: 'auto', + paddingRight: 16, + scrollbarWidth: 'none', + msOverflowStyle: 'none', + }} classNames={{ ...modal?.classNames, ...modalClassNames,